> > I have a supermicro server which is flooded of kernel message:
> > ahci 0000:e6:00.0: AMD-Vi: Event logged [IO_PAGE_FAULT domain=0x0055 address=0xa14a4000 flags=0x0070]
> 
> 0x70 means, Page was present, its write request, but device doesn't have
> required permission.
> 
> As Robin mentioned, it could be FW region. Can you please double check?
